A predictive dialer is an automated dialing system used in call centers to increase efficiency and productivity. It dials a list of telephone numbers and connects answered calls to agents. The predictive dialer uses algorithms to screen out busy signals, voicemails, and unanswered calls, ensuring that agents only speak to live customers. This technology helps maximize agent talk time by eliminating manual dialing and waiting times between calls. Predictive dialers are designed to improve contact rates, increase the number of customer calls made in a shorter period, and ultimately enhance the overall performance of outbound call centers.

Predictive dialers are a perfect solution for call centers who handle large outbound call volume. Predictive dialers are highly efficient because agents are connected only once someone answers the phone. They are capable of making many calls at one time. When a person answers, they are automatically routed to the next available agent. Any time the software reaches a voicemail or busy signal, it disconnects and continues on to a different number. When agents finish up their call, they are disconnected and can be sent back to the queue to wait for the next one.
A predictive dialing solution connects to agents to live callers as soon as an agent is done with the previous call. Predictive dialer systems algorithmically determine when the next call should take place based on metrics like average call duration. The system dials several numbers at the same time until a caller picks up and then directs the customer to the open agent. This is one of the more productive and speedy outbound calling options. There are risks, however, as it is more likely a live caller could end up on the phone with no one on the other end, leading to abandoned calls.
